Name : Prefab House
Composition: Calcium Silicate Board as face panel, Cement, EPS and fly ash as core
Size:1500-3000*610*60(75,90,100,120,150,180) (L*W*T)(mm)

Application: For interior and exterior wall partition on steel or concrete structure building, new construction or renovations. It can replace construction materials such as red brick,air brick ,color-coated steel sandwich board ,gypsum block, wire spatial grid structure perlite board, perlite porous board and etc. It can widely be applied to wall materials of various high and low buildings such as bank, office building, hospital, school, hotel, mall, amusement, old house reconstruction, residence and workshop.
Technology Index:
| Item | National Standards | Testing Indexes | ||||
60mm | 90mm | 120mm | 60mm | 90mm | 120mm | ||
1 | Anti-impact Capacity/times | ≥5 | ≥5 | ≥5 | ≥8 | ≥10 | ≥15 |
2 | Anti-bending damage load/times over deadweight | ≥1.5 | ≥1.5 | ≥1.5 | ≥3 | ≥4 | ≥5 |
3 | Compressive strength /Mpa | ≥3.5 | ≥3.5 | ≥3.5 | ≥5 | ≥5 | ≥5 |
4 | Softening coefficient | ≥0.80 | ≥0.80 | ≥0.80 | ≥1 | ≥1 | ≥1 |
5 | Surface density g/m2 | ≤70 | ≤90 | ≤110 | ≤55 | ≤70 | ≤85 |
6 | Moisture rate a/% | ≤12/10/8 | ≤10/9/7 | ||||
7 | Drying shrinkage value /mm/m | ≤0.6 | ≤0.6 | ≤0.6 | ≤0.45 | ≤.0.5 | ≤0.5 |
8 | Hanging Force/N | ≥1000 | ≥1000 | ≥1000 | ≥1200 | ≥1300 | ≥1500 |
9 | Sound insulation capacity in the air /dB | ≥30 | ≥35 | ≥40 | ≥35 | ≥40 | ≥45 |
10 | Fire proof limit /h | ≥1 | ≥1 | ≥1 | ≥2.5 | ≥3 | ≥4 |
